What is the maximum operating frequency of PIC16F1459-I/ML?
- The maximum operating frequency of PIC16F1459-I/ML is 48 MHz.
Can PIC16F1459-I/ML be used for USB applications?
- Yes, PIC16F1459-I/ML has built-in USB functionality and can be used for USB applications.
What are the available communication interfaces on PIC16F1459-I/ML?
- PIC16F1459-I/ML supports SPI, I2C, and UART communication interfaces.
